The works by David Blackwood in this session comprise some of the most carefully selected examples possible. This meticulously assembled collection was built by collectors who were often given the opportunity to select their impressions in advance of exhibitions, allowing them to choose the strongest, most pristinely printed works. Their selections were then archivally framed, many by the noted Emmett’s Frames of Toronto, maintaining their ideal condition.
Please note that this work is uniquely titled. The artist titled this first impression Study for Heber Fifield, with the remainer of the edition titled Study for Great Mummer.
